Realme is reportedly set to launch Realme Q3, a mid-range 5G mobile phone, in China. The to-be-announced phone will be a successor to the previously launched Realme Q2. A leak hints Realme Q3 to be powered by a MediaTek Dimensity 1100 processor. 

Realme confirms the arrival of Realme Q3 on the Chinese microblogging site Weibo yet without revealing the launch date. The company is looking to provide a ‘balance of performance and price’ with the Realme Q3. Also, the brand says that the Realme Q2 lineup was sold to over 1 million units since the launch.

While Realme Q3 is around the corner, it has waved rumor mills with various leaks and revelations. A source claims that the Realme Q3 will sport a display with a refresh rate of 120Hz. The phone is said to pack a 4500mAh battery with a 65W fast charger in the box.

For the design of the Realme Q3, the handset is suggested to follow the brand’s pattern which includes a punch-hole display at the front and a quad rear camera at the back. Also, the source is expecting the phone to come under 2,000 Yuan (around Rs. 22,800). This is the first bit of speculation which we suggest taking with a pinch of salt.

Since the Realme Q2 lineup was limited to China, the company has availed Realme Q2 5G in the Indian market rebadged as Realme Narzo 30 Pro (review). It may be possible that the Realme Q3 could follow in the same footsteps.
